Diving into the Spiritual Significance: Biblical Meanings of Relaxing in Dreams

Peace and Calmness

When you dream about relaxation, you are likely feeling at peace and calm in your life. You may be feeling content with your current situation and are not experiencing any major stressors. This dream could also be a sign that you need to take some time for yourself to relax and de-stress. The Bible often talks about the importance of peace and calmness, and it encourages us to seek these qualities in our lives. In the book of Psalms, it says, "He makes me lie down in green pastures, he leads me beside quiet waters, he refreshes my soul" (Psalm 23:2-3). This verse describes a peaceful and calm setting that can help to restore our spirits. When we are feeling relaxed, we are better able to connect with God and experience His peace.

Victory over Anxiety and Stress

The sensation of relaxation in dreams is a sign of victory over anxiety and stress. It indicates that you are able to let go of your worries and concerns, and find peace and tranquility within yourself. This sense of relaxation can also be a sign of spiritual growth and development, as you are becoming more in tune with your inner self and the world around you.

Biblically, relaxation is often associated with the idea of rest and Sabbath. In the Old Testament, God commanded the Israelites to observe a Sabbath day of rest each week, in order to refresh their bodies and minds and connect with Him. Similarly, in the New Testament, Jesus encouraged his followers to come to him for rest and refreshment, saying, "Come to me, all you who are weary and burdened, and I will give you rest" (Matthew 11:28).

When you experience relaxation in a dream, it is a reminder that you are not alone in your struggles, and that there is a source of peace and comfort available to you. It is an invitation to let go of your worries and concerns, and to trust in God's love and care for you.

Cultural and Historical Perspective of Dream Symbol: Relax


The Common Bond: A Timeless Symbol of Relief

Across cultures and centuries, dreams of relaxation have transcended boundaries. From ancient civilizations to modern times, people have found comfort and rejuvenation within the realm of dreams.

In the East, dreams of relaxation are often associated with spiritual enlightenment and inner peace. For instance, in Buddhism and Taoism, dreams of floating through tranquil waters or serene landscapes are believed to signify a connection to the universe and a path towards inner harmony.

In Native American cultures, dreams of relaxation are often seen as a sign of harmony with nature. Dreaming of a peaceful forest or a babbling brook was thought to bring balance and tranquility to the dreamer's life.

In ancient Greece, relaxation dreams were associated with divine intervention. Gods and goddesses were believed to visit people through dreams, bringing them moments of peace and relaxation as a sign of favor or as a way to impart wisdom.

In the modern world, the interpretation of relaxation dreams can vary greatly depending on an individual's personal experiences and beliefs. However, dreams of relaxation often hold a common thread: a longing for calm and a desire to escape the stresses of everyday life.
